Interesting locations in Mexico

One of the largest tourist destinations in the world is Mexico. In 2005, it ranked 7th as world’s most visited country and the only Latin American nation included in the top 25. By the end of 2006, Mexico hosted almost 22 millions of foreign tourists according to a World Tourism Organization. The most popular tourist destinations are the breathtaking beach resorts and the ancient Meso-American ruins. December and mid-Summer are the peak seasons for tourists.

Most popular beaches resort that are known around the world include Acapulco, a “paradise spot” and notable for its nightlife and American and Mexican restaurants; and Ixtapa, recognized for various water activities such as fishing and parasailing. Other top-notch beaches are the Puerto Vallarta, Cabo San Lucas in Baja California Sur, Guaymas, Puerto Escondido, Huatulco, Cancun, Ensenada, and Playa del Carmen. The Meso-American ruins consist of the town of Malinalco, Chichen-Itza, Monte-Alban, Palenque, Xochicalco and Teotihuacan.

Some of the notable sites that attract tourists are situated right at the heart of Mexico City such as the Pyramid of the Moon, Pyramid of the Sun, Plaza de Toros Mexico (world's biggest bullring), Mexican National Palace (established on the site of Moctezuma's palace, and the National Museum of Anthropology and History. Some historical sites, buildings and churches that are definitely worth visiting include Querétaro where the 3rd tallest monolith in the world is found; Guanajuato, UNESCO declared the whole city as a World Heritage Site; Campeche, also a World Heritage Site and the only walled city in Mexico; and Zacatecas where its cathedral is adorned in baroque style.
